What are the opposite words for dragged oneself?
The antonyms for the phrase "dragged oneself" could include words such as propelled, propelled oneself, moved briskly, strode, marched, jogged, skipped, or danced. These words all imply a sense of liveliness, energy, and enthusiasm for movement, rather than the lethargy and effort implied by the phrase "dragged oneself."
